Best Practices for Building a Successful B2B Wholesale Network
Building a successful B2B wholesale network requires strategic planning and execution. Strong relationships with suppliers, manufacturers, and customers are essential for driving business growth in this competitive marketplace.
1. Identify Your Ideal Partners
Begin by identifying the characteristics of your ideal partners. Whether they are manufacturers, distributors, or service providers, clarity on your goals will help you target the right relationships.
2. Foster Open Communication
Open lines of communication are critical for a successful wholesale network. Regularly engage with your partners through meetings, newsletters, and digital platforms to ensure everyone is aligned and informed.
3. Leverage Digital Tools
Utilize digital tools and platforms to facilitate collaboration. Cloud-based solutions and project management tools can enhance coordination and streamline operations.
4. Focus on Relationship Building
Relationship building is key to a thriving wholesale network. Attend industry events, trade shows, and networking gatherings to connect with potential partners and strengthen existing relationships.
5. Measure and Adapt
Continuously measure the performance of your network and adapt strategies as needed. Solicit feedback from partners to identify areas for improvement and celebrate successes together.
Conclusion
By implementing these best practices, businesses can build a robust B2B wholesale network that fosters strong relationships and drives long-term success. A well-connected network is a powerful asset in navigating the complexities of the wholesale industry.
